我不知道的代码行上的PHP错误';我不明白

我不知道的代码行上的PHP错误';我不明白,php,Php,我在此代码上有一个错误: 代码: $sessionsAry[] .= array('SessionId'=>$row['SessionId'], 'Mark'=>$row['Mark']); 错误: 分析错误:语法错误,第122行的/web/stud/u0867587/Mobile\u app/student\u overall\u grade.php中出现意外的T_变量 此错误是什么意思?此特定代码的错误在哪里?首先,删除“.” $sessionsAry[] = array('S

我在此代码上有一个错误:

代码:

$sessionsAry[] .= array('SessionId'=>$row['SessionId'], 'Mark'=>$row['Mark']);
错误:

分析错误:语法错误,第122行的/web/stud/u0867587/Mobile\u app/student\u overall\u grade.php中出现意外的T_变量

此错误是什么意思?此特定代码的错误在哪里?

首先,删除“.”

$sessionsAry[] = array('SessionId'=>$row['SessionId'], 'Mark'=>$row['Mark']);
现在,如果仍然出现错误,请确保
$sessionsAry
是一个数组,并且
$row
也是一个数组。尝试:

var_dump($sessionsAry, $row);
另外,确保你没有错过一个“;”在前面的行中。

首先,删除“.”

$sessionsAry[] = array('SessionId'=>$row['SessionId'], 'Mark'=>$row['Mark']);
现在,如果仍然出现错误,请确保
$sessionsAry
是一个数组,并且
$row
也是一个数组。尝试:

var_dump($sessionsAry, $row);

另外,确保你没有错过一个“;”在前面的行中。

您不需要编写
=
,因为
$array[]
$array
添加一个新条目。因此,只需使用
=

即可,因为
$array[]
$array
添加了一个新条目,所以无需编写
=
。所以,在第121行使用
=
就可以了,你肯定忘了放分号,这通常是对这个错误的一种解释。

在第121行你肯定忘了放分号,这通常是对这个错误的一种解释。

当你看到PHP发出的“解析错误”时,通常意味着你忘了一个字符(;)或表达式格式不正确(.=有一个额外的句点)。考虑一个新的PHP IDE,它可以在运行代码之前指出错误。它将极大地帮助您加快用PHP编写代码的速度。

当您看到PHP发出的“解析错误”时,通常意味着您忘记了字符(;)或表达式格式不正确(.=有一个额外的句点)。考虑一个新的PHP IDE,它可以在运行代码之前指出错误。它将极大地帮助您加快用PHP编写代码的速度。

我首先将
$sessionsAry[]转换为
$sessionsAry[]=
前面的代码行是什么?在PHP中,很多时候这实际上意味着你在前一行中留下了一个分号,或者类似的东西。这一行的第一个标记很可能是意外的,因为前一行[s]上有某些内容。我首先将
$sessionsAry[]设置为
$sessionsAry[]=
$sessionsAry[]=
上一行代码是什么?在PHP中,很多时候这实际上意味着你在前一行中留下了一个分号,或者类似的东西。由于前一行[s]中的某些内容,该行的第一个标记很可能是意外的。检查
$sessionsAry
$row
与此无关
=
也不太可能。检查
$sessionary
$row
在此处不相关<代码>=
也不太可能。